The present disclosure relates to a swimming aid. The swimming auxiliary apparatus comprises: a positioning plate formed as a curved surface; The binding part is configured as a flexible structure, and one end of the binding part is fixedly connected to one side of the positioning plate, and the other end of the binding part is removably connected to the other side of the positioning plate, so that when both ends of the binding part are connected to both sides of the positioning plate, it can be bound to the body; The swimming fin piece is rotatably connected to the positioning plate, and the swimming fin piece has a light and thin unfolding surface to slide the water; One end of the elastic reset part is connected to the positioning plate, and the other end is connected to the swimming fin part; When the water resistance of the expanded surface when it moves the water body is greater than the critical value, the elastic reset part is compressed and the swimming fin part deflects; When the water resistance of the unfolding surface is less than the critical value, the elastic reset piece can extend to help the fin swimmer reset. [0002]游泳,即我们的手、臂和腿推水时,水同时以大小相等的反作用力推进我们前进。水的密度大约是空气的1000倍。不像跑步、骑自行车或者其它常见的人类运动形式可以将肌肉的大部分能量转换成前进运动,我们游泳时几乎要消耗90%多的能量去克服液体的阻力。
[0003]流体动力学告诉我们,游泳运动效率取决于二个基本因素,即我们施加的推进力和我们遭遇到的阻力或者是障碍力。人们为了提高游泳运动效率,常使用例如划水掌、手蹼、脚蹼等现有的游泳辅助器具来增加游泳者肢体划水面积,进而提高能量转换率。但划水掌、手蹼会妨碍佩戴者手掌的抓取,脚蹼会妨碍佩戴者行走,使得游泳者的活动方式和活动范围受限。
[0004]对此,针对现有技术中划水掌、手蹼、脚蹼等器材影响游泳者肢体基本功能正常使用的问题,还需要提出一种更为合理的技术方案,以解决当前的技术问题。
